Overview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ension

Pediazole 100mg Oral Suspension, an antibiotic, effectively treats various bacterial infections in children affecting the ears, eyes, nose, throat, lungs, skin, and digestive system. Its mechanism involves halting bacterial growth and replication, thus curbing infection spread. Administer this suspension once daily, ideally in the morning, except for typhoid, which necessitates twice-daily dosing. Give it with or without food, consistently at the same time each day; however, food is recommended to minimize potential stomach upset. Dosage is determined by the infection type, severity, and the child's age and weight; strictly adhere to the prescribed regimen. If vomiting occurs within 30 minutes of administration, repeat the dose. Improvement may be seen within 48 hours, but complete the entire course to prevent relapse or complications. Common, usually transient side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al discomfort. Persistent or severe side effects warrant immediate medical attention. Always disclose any prior allergies, heart conditions, liver or kidney issues to your child's physician to ensure appropriate dosage and treatment planning.

How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ension works:

Savazee 100mg oral suspension is an antibacterial medication. Its mechanism of action involves disrupting the production of vital bacterial proteins, thereby halting bacterial proliferation and containing the spread of infection.

SAFETY ADVICE

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Exercise caution when administering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ension to individuals with advanced kidney disease; dosage modification may be necessary. Consult a physician for guidance.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ension is typically well-tolerated in children exhibiting mild to moderate kidney dysfunction; dosage adjustments are usually unnecessary in pediatric patients with kidney issues.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ult your physician for guidance. If symptoms suggestive of hepatitis, such as pallor, nausea, and fatigue, appear, stop taking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ension immediately.

What if you forget to take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ension :

Remain calm. If your pediatrician hasn't prescribed otherwise, administer the missed dose immediately upon recollection, provided at least twelve hours separate it from the next scheduled dose.

FAQs on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ension

Accidental overdose of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ension is unlikely to be harmful. However, contact a doctor immediately if you suspect an overdose has occurred, as it could cause adverse reactions or worsen your child's condition.
This medication may cause serious side effects such as persistent vomiting, kidney problems, allergic reactions, diarrhea, and severe gastrointestinal infections. Consult your child's doctor immediately if any of these occur.
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ension may interact with other medications. Inform your child's doctor about all other medications your child is taking before administering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ension, and always consult your child's doctor before giving your child any medication.
Generally, antibiotics don't interact negatively with vaccine components or cause adverse reactions in recently vaccinated children. Nevertheless, vaccination should be postponed for children receiving antibiotics until their illness resolves. The vaccine can be administered once your child has recovered.
Your child's doctor might recommend regular kidney and liver function tests to monitor their health.
Children's sensitive stomachs can be upset by medication, including antibiotics like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ension. This medication can affect beneficial gut bacteria, potentially increasing the risk of other infections. If your child experiences diarrhea while taking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ension, don't stop the medication; contact their doctor for guidance on next steps, which may include a dose adjustment.
Treatment length varies depending on the infection and patient age.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ension isn't always a 3-day course. Typical bacterial infections often require 500mg daily for three days, or 500mg on day one followed by 250mg daily for days two through five. For conditions like genital ulcer disease, a single 1 gram dose may suffice. Always follow your doctor's prescribed regimen.
To maximize the effectiveness of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ension, avoid concurrent use with antacids. Also, limit sun exposure and avoid tanning beds due to increased sunburn risk while taking this medication.
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ension is an effective antibiotic treating various bacterial infections. Its extended half-life allows once-daily dosing for shorter treatment durations, unlike other antibiotics with shorter half-lives requiring more frequent administration (twice, thrice, or four times daily).
Savazee 100mg Oral Suspension may cause thrush (a fungal or yeast infection) by eliminating beneficial gut bacteria that normally prevent it. Report any oral thrush (white patches in the mouth or on the tongue), vaginal itching or discharge, or soreness to your doctor, especially if these symptoms occur during or shortly after treatment.
